Hi Alex,

Can you try add the following two lines to your flink-conf.yaml?

  akka.framesize: 314572800b
  akka.client.timeout: 10min

AFAIK it is not needed to use Java system properties here.

> I am using Flink version 1.4.2.  When I try to run my application on a
> Yarn cluster, I get this error:
>
> 2018-04-23 14:08:13,346 ERROR akka.remote.EndpointWriter
>                   - Transient association error (association remains live)
> akka.remote.OversizedPayloadException: Discarding oversized payload sent
> to Actor[akka.tcp://flink@XXXX:37877/user/jobmanager#1227317945]: max
> allowed size 10485760 bytes, actual size of encoded
> class 
> org.apache.flink.runtime.messages.JobManagerMessages$LeaderSessionMessage
> was 213691138 bytes.
>
>
> I am trying to override the default limit in my *flink-conf.yaml *file:
>
> env.java.opts: -Dakka.framesize=314572800b -Dakka.client.timeout=10min
>
>
> I can verify this setting shows up in the Job Manager Web UI:
>
> Key Value
> env.java.opts -Dakka.framesize=314572800b -Dakka.client.timeout=10min
>
>
> I am submitting the Job with the command line client:
>
> flink run -m …
>
> No matter what I do, I always get the same error message with the same
> default limit.  Please help, I am not finding any information on how to
> override the default limit.
